Sidewalk Enlargement in Denver, CO
Sidewalk enlargement services involve expanding existing walkways to improve accessibility, safety, and curb appeal for residential properties. These projects typically include widening or extending sidewalks to accommodate increased foot traffic, meet accessibility standards, or enhance the overall appearance of a property. Homeowners interested in sidewalk enlargement often want to understand the scope of work, including materials used, potential disruptions during construction, and how the project might impact existing landscaping or property features.
Before requesting sidewalk enlargement, property owners usually seek information about the necessary permits, the estimated timeline for completion, and any preparation required on their part. It’s also common to inquire about the durability and maintenance of the materials used, as well as how the expanded sidewalk will integrate with existing walkways or driveways. Clear understanding of these details helps ensure the project aligns with the property’s needs and local regulations.

Sidewalk Enlargement Questions
What is sidewalk enlargement? It involves expanding or modifying existing sidewalks to improve accessibility, safety, or accommodate additional pedestrian traffic.
What types of projects are common? Projects often include widening sidewalks, adding curb extensions, or creating accessible ramps for better pedestrian flow.
Who should consider sidewalk enlargement? Property owners seeking to enhance walkability or comply with local accessibility requirements may find this service beneficial.
What should property owners know before starting? It’s important to assess existing sidewalk conditions and understand local regulations related to sidewalk modifications.
